Flipper's Guitar
64,864 listeners
Flipper's Guitar were a Tokyo-based Japanese pop duo formed by Keigo Oyamada (小山田圭吾, better known as Cornelius) and Kenji Ozawa (小沢健二, nephew of famed conductor Seiji Ozawa) in 1987. The band was influenced by the chirpy sound of British 80s pop groups like Haircut 100, The Style Council and… read more -
